§ 37-1-45 — Sitting or Conferring with Commissions of Other States
Alabama·Title 37 Public Utilities and Public Transportation·Ch. 1 Public Service Commission·Art. 2 Powers and Duties Generally·Div. 1 General Provisions
The members of the commission may sit with and confer with other state utility commissions and public service commissions, either within or without the state, in general utility matters; but in no event shall the commission make any order without proceeding to carry out the other provisions of this title in respect to notice and hearings.

Legislative History
(Acts 1920, No. 42, p. 92; Code 1923, §9721; Code 1940, T. 48, §32.)
